Krzysztof Obłój (born October 30, 1954 ) is a Polish economist and university professor. He is the head of the Institute for Strategic Management (pol .: Zakład Zarządzania Strategicznego ) at the Management Faculty of Warsaw University . In addition, he holds the Chair of Strategic Management at the Leon Koźmiński Private Academy in Warsaw .

Life

Krzysztof Obłój is the son of the chemist Józef Obłój. In 1977 he graduated from what was then Szkoła Planowania i Statystyki . He then worked as an assistant at the University of Warsaw, and after his doctorate (subject: organizational and management theory) as a lecturer from 1980. In 1987 he completed his habilitation at the University of Warsaw (subject: strategic management). From 1993 to 1994 he was President of the European International Business Academy (EIBA), of which he has been a Fellow since 2002. From 1995 he has been teaching as a professor at the Leon Kozmiński University and since 1996 as a full professor at the University of Warsaw. In 1996 and 1997 he was a Fulbright scholar.

As a visiting professor , he regularly teaches at Sun Yat-sen University Guangdong , ESCP Europe , BI Norwegian Business School , Henley Management College , University of Illinois at Urbana , Yale University , Central Connecticut State University and from Duquesne University in Pittsburgh .

Obłój was and is widely published. In the United States , the books “Management Systems” (1993) and “Winning: Continuous Improvement Theory in High Performance Organizations” (1995) were published. Some of his books published in Poland have become bestsellers and have already appeared in several editions: “Strategia sukcesu firmy,” (1996, 1997, 1998, 1999, 2000 and 2004), “Strategia organizacji” (1999, 2000, 2002, 2004 and 2007 ) or “Pasja i dyscyplina strategii” (2010 and 2011). The work “Myśli o nowoczesnym biznesie” was created in 2003 in collaboration with Janusz Palikot , and “Zarys teorii równowagi organizacyjnej” (1986) in cooperation with Andrzej Koźmiński .

Obłój worked as a strategy and organizational consultant for the Polish branches of corporations such as Asea Brown Boveri , LG Group and Reckitt Benckiser . He is chairman of the supervisory boards of Alior Bank SA and Prochem SA. He previously held positions on the supervisory board (often as chairman) at Agora SA , Ambra SA , Eurobank SA , Impel SA , NFI Foksal SA , PGF SA , PKN Orlen SA , Polmos Lublin SA and PZU SA off.
